TwitterSnooze! - Give your chatty Twitter friends a timeout

TwitterSnooze! - Time out your chatty Twitter friends
Sometimes even the best in our Twitterati can break the unspoken twittettiquette and pollute what was once a beautiful arrangement of tweets with excessive twitterage. Or maybe they are just at a conference about turning door knobs with your teeth and you wish you could just tune them out while they rage on about the best way to mend a chipped tooth on the fly from a failed attempt. Or something like that.

Well TwitterSnooze! let's you get back in touch with the Twitter you love by giving the people that are harshing your mellow a timeout and putting the zen back into your Twitter. Simply enter your username and password, the person you want to snooze, and how long you want them out of your hair for (between 1 and 30 days). The only real side effect is that they will get an e-mail update that they have been unfollowed, but you can have the fact that they are merely being "snoozed" announced in your Twitter stream to avoid any confusion.

Time Out: take breaks from your Mac

Time Out for MacTime Out is an app for Mac OS X (similar to Workrave) that is geared towards reminding you to take breaks from your computer, which can ultimately prevent repetitive-strain injury (RSI). Time Out is free and includes two types of breaks: normal and micro. Normal breaks are less frequent, but longer in duration, and micro breaks are more frequent but only last for about 10 seconds.

When it's time for a break, the screen will slowly fade into the Time Out screen with a progress bar showing you the remaining time of the current break. You also have the option to postpone the break for 5 or 10 minutes, or to skip it completely.

The program is highly customizable. You can set break length, frequency, and even the color and fade length Time Out will use when it's time for a break. Scripts, Adium status, and iTunes pause/play can even be triggered during breaks (so, for instance, your music can be stopped during a break, then resumed when the break is over).
